Transaction 3371ecba69e5f216d8048431a38d1975cb39bb251ff48f8f1e60700231116342
1 Input
1 Output
-
3371ecba69e5f216d8048431a38d1975cb39bb251ff48f8f1e60700231116342:0
- value
- 326848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a03cc00ba0b4ac16c7b8e9a5dada0dab0bb4323a OP_EQUAL
- address
- 3GJGpETtWfVL6YqygLXLpymNi7iSUsuSeh